Luckily, this seems a good opportunity to do so, because the most important international agreement regarding space exploration has just been signed: the Artemis Accords.<\/p>\n<p>There are many things that are great about outer space\u2014zero gravity! shooting stars! aliens, maybe!\u2014but I think we can all agree that its most attractive feature is that it is not directly adjacent to the United States. Location is everything, and outer space was clever enough to position itself with an entire atmosphere between its boundary and the rapid descent into madness of the planet\u2019s single most powerful actor.<\/p>\n<p>Now, the Artemis Accords aren\u2019t strictly designed to facilitate moon colonization (which is, granted, not 100 per cent legal), but as they regulate space exploration, they\u2019re currently the closest thing we have to a launchpad for the 38 million or so of our prospective lunar colonists. Here are the new rules, then, for \u201cexploring\u201d the moon.<\/p>\n<p>Among other things, we\u2019d have to: land only for peaceful purposes (Canada\u2019s previous exploration\/colonization efforts may compromise our credibility on this point, but presumably observers will be reassured by the obligingly unthreatening status of our defence spending); be transparent about our moon business (\u201cWe\u2019re just here for the meteor views!\u201d); \u201cutilize current interoperability standards for space-based infrastructure\u201d (I don\u2019t know what any of that means, and it is doubtful a space law enforcement officer would either); help other countries\u2019 space personnel in distress (fine, but unnecessary\u2014wherever they\u2019re from, and however far it is from the United States, space personnel will be relieved to be somewhere further). Also: preserve humanity\u2019s outer space heritage (strict crater building codes); extract moon resources sustainably (no Helium-3 fracking); respect other countries\u2019 moon-based activities (no space pod sabotage); mitigate and limit space debris (no lunar littering).<\/p>\n<p>Aside from some potential funny business around private lunar mining endeavours that one of our top international legal minds has inconveniently pointed out, compared to being next door to the States this all sounds okay, so where do we sign? . . . Oh! We already have. Even better. Who did we sign with? . . . Oh.<\/p>\n<p>There is one issue. The accords are a <a href=\"https:\/\/buradabiliyorum.com\/en\/category\/watch-movies-tv-seriess\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"8\" title=\"Watch Movies &amp; TV Series\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">series<\/a> of bilateral agreements, made between various governments and one other government . . . that being the United States. The accords effectively make the United States in charge of outer space.<\/p>\n<p>None of us need anticipate what the United States will do in the future to know what we will fear: however much foreign leaders trusted or distrusted the U.S. before Trump was elected, they trusted it less after.
